I had posted a few months back that my mom and I were planning a trip to Universal specifically to visit the WWoHP. We absolutely loved the WWoHP!! I don't like thrill rides but because of my HP obsession, I vowed to try the FJ ride at least once. We stayed at Disney and then took Mears over to Universal. We met two other mother-daughter groups on the bus and we stuck together to do FJ. It was tons of fun, and I loved the ride - I even wound up riding it 3 more times that day! We also saw the Ollivander show, saw the Triwizard pep rally, ate at the Three Broomsticks, and walked through the rest of the WWoHP. Also, I have a nut allergy and was able to have the butterbeer (they told me the FDA has certified it as nut free but it is made in a bakery)! The frozen was delicious!

I'd say that if anyone is a big HP fan, it is definitely worth a trip to Universal. I have to say I didn't like the rest of Universal. I'm too much of a Disney purist and don't like thrill rides so there was really nothing else for me there. We bought the Costco tickets, which worked out well because we were able to go both parks and can go back to HP as an excursion on another WDW trip. I liked Islands better than Studios because it had theming and we thought the Dr. Seuss land was cute, in addition to the WWoHP.

Definitely a successful trip! :)
